WEEK-1 ORIGINS OF HOSPITALITY AND

HOUSEKEEPING
Hospitality is the cordial and generous
reception and entertainment of guests , either
socially or commercially.

Regardless of the reasons people go to a


place away from home, they will need care.
They need a clean& comfortable place to sleep
and rest, food service, area for meeting other
people, access to stores and shops and secure
surroundings.
 In the early 1700s travellers stayed in
roadhouses, missions, inns or private homes
and Housekeeping may have included only a
bed of straw that was changed weekly.
 Just as the traveller of earlier times had a
choice, there is a wide choice for travellers
today and that creates compitition between
hotels.
 From that point of view, we can say that
professional housekeeping requires a staff
with a sense of pride.
HOUSEKEEPING AND
MANAGEMENT THEORIES
 Housekeeping as the largest department in terms of
people is managed by the Executive Housekeeper or
Director of Housekeeping.

 Cleanliness is the key to success of this depertment.


Between the duties of Executive Housekeeper there are:
 Leadership of people, equipment and supplies
 Ensuring the cleanliness and servicing the guest rooms
and public areas
 Operating the department according to financial
guidelines
 Keeping records
 There are several different management
theories,for example:
 Administrative Mngm. Theory (H.Fayol)
 Scientific Mngm. (F. Taylor)
 Participative Management (R. Likert) and
other theories....
 Most common fuctions of management
are as follows:
 Planning
 Organizing

 Staffing

 Directing

 Controlling
 Now,our question is, “ How can the
Executive Housekeeper apply these
diverse theories to the job at hand, that
is the managing of HK. Department?
 In order to more effectively manage
housekeeping employees, we must
understand their demographic
characteristics.
 Diversity among housekeeping
employees is a very common situation in
most hotels.
 Following characteristics can be found in many
housekeeping departments:
a- Cultural diversity( people of different cultures)
b- Variety of languages ( accents,pronouncing
of languages)
c- Little education
d- Lower socioeconomic backgrounds
e- Emotional or economic problems, sometimes
a dependency problem
 Having such normative characteristics
among housekeeping employees, in
order to create proper attitudes,
motivation and productivity, the Director
of Housekeeping should apply all of
the management theories .
 Each of them is appropriate at different
times, this is called Situational
Leadership or the Contingency
Approach.
 “ There is no -one best- way to manage!
Flexibility is the key to succesfull
management!”
 “Different problems require different
solutions!”
